Hi 您目前尚未登陆
请选择 进入手机版 | 继续访问电脑版
设为首页收藏本站

上官雨伦

2006年接触 Discuz。原 New.Discuz! Support Team 开发团队负责人,致力于网页前端设计。现职河北省张家口市职业技术学院教师。

Discuz小技巧 - 全站任意数值实现虚拟化 heatlevel

2017-12-08 17:09:19 发布

Discuz /[教程] 977 0 0

上官雨伦Writer

张家口市 | 博主、教师

90

主题

99

帖子

99

积分

Admin

Rank: 16

积分
99
发表于 2017-12-8 17:09 | 显示全部楼层 |阅读模式 [离线请留言]
有时为了提高论坛的活跃度,部分数值做虚拟化是再好不过了。但是碍于插件的局限性和复杂性,这里测试了一个简单的虚拟化数值的方法。
以论坛首页的会员数量为例。
在模板里,会员数值的变量为
$_G['cache']['userstats']['totalmembers']

我们可以自定义一个变量然后给予任意的算法。如:
$member = round($_G['cache']['userstats']['totalmembers']*100);

虚拟会员数($member) = 实际会员数($_G['cache']['userstats']['totalmembers']) * 100

0 使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

当前话题还没有评论,来做第一个评论的人吧 ♪(^∇^*)